package proto
import (
"bytes"
"testing"
)
// BenchmarkWriteArgs benchmarks writing command arguments
func BenchmarkWriteArgs(b *testing.B) {
testCases := []struct {
name string
args []interface{}
}{
{
name: "simple_get",
args: []interface{}{"GET", "key"},
},
{
name: "simple_set",
args: []interface{}{"SET", "key", "value"},
},
{
name: "set_with_expiry",
args: []interface{}{"SET", "key", "value", "EX", 3600},
},
{
name: "zadd",
args: []interface{}{"ZADD", "myset", 1.0, "member1", 2.0, "member2", 3.0, "member3"},
},
{
name: "large_command",
args: make([]interface{}, 100),
},
}
// Initialize large command
for i := range testCases[len(testCases)-1].args {
testCases[len(testCases)-1].args[i] = "arg"
}
for _, tc := range testCases {
b.Run(tc.name, func(b *testing.B) {
buf := &bytes.Buffer{}
wr := NewWriter(buf)
b.ResetTimer()
b.ReportAllocs()
for i := 0; i < b.N; i++ {
buf.Reset()
if err := wr.WriteArgs(tc.args); err != nil {
b.Fatal(err)
}
}
})
}
}
// BenchmarkWriteArgsParallel benchmarks concurrent writes
func BenchmarkWriteArgsParallel(b *testing.B) {
args := []interface{}{"SET", "key", "value", "EX", 3600}
b.ReportAllocs()
b.RunParallel(func(pb *testing.PB) {
buf := &bytes.Buffer{}
wr := NewWriter(buf)
for pb.Next() {
buf.Reset()
if err := wr.WriteArgs(args); err != nil {
b.Fatal(err)
}
}
})
}
// BenchmarkWriteCmds benchmarks writing multiple commands (pipeline)
func BenchmarkWriteCmds(b *testing.B) {
sizes := []int{1, 10, 50, 100, 500}
for _, size := range sizes {
b.Run(string(rune('0'+size/10)), func(b *testing.B) {
// Create commands
cmds := make([][]interface{}, size)
for i := range cmds {
cmds[i] = []interface{}{"SET", "key", i}
}
buf := &bytes.Buffer{}
wr := NewWriter(buf)
b.ResetTimer()
b.ReportAllocs()
for i := 0; i < b.N; i++ {
buf.Reset()
for _, args := range cmds {
if err := wr.WriteArgs(args); err != nil {
b.Fatal(err)
}
}
}
})
}
}
